8. Misreading the burette and improper endpoint detection; 9. Benedict's test; 10. Starch molecules are too large to pass through the membrane. Explanation 1. Identify potential mistakes in titration 1. **Misreading the burette**: Incorrectly reading the meniscus level can lead to inaccurate volume measurements. 2. **Improper endpoint detection**: Failing to accurately identify the color change at the endpoint can result in incorrect titration results. 2. Confirm presence of glucose outside dialysis bag **Benedict's test**: This test confirms the presence of glucose by changing color when glucose is present after heating. 3. Conclusion from no starch detection outside dialysis bag **Starch molecules are too large** to pass through the semi-permeable membrane of the dialysis bag, indicating selective permeability.
